Salt Composition

Phenylephrine (5mg) + Chlorpheniramine Maleate (2mg) + Dextromethorphan Hydrobromide (10mg)

How Mondikuf DX Syrup works:

Mondikuf DX Syrup combines three active ingredients to address cold and allergy symptoms. Phenylephrine, a decongestant, constricts blood vessels in the nasal passages, easing stuffiness. Chlorpheniramine Maleate, an antihistamine, alleviates allergic reactions such as sneezing, runny nose, and watery eyes. Finally, Dextromethorphan Hydrobromide, an antitussive, calms coughs by suppressing the brain's cough reflex.
